Data Scientist
(Permanent)

Revenue

Location: Dublin

Role Purpose:
- Solve complex real-world business problems using cutting-edge machine learning methods and techniques.
- Develop data-driven models and tools to optimise trading performance across a host of domains including pricing and recommended sort.
- Conduct exploratory analysis to generate actionable insights, identify opportunities, and enhance our understanding of consumer behaviours. 

Reporting to: Head of Data Science

Key Duties & Responsibilities

  • Developing industry leading data science solutions through:
  • Defining data requirements and extracting required data to support solution development.
  • Performing exploratory data analysis to improve understanding of underlying trends and behaviours to help inform feature engineering work and next steps in modelling process.
  • Support in the designing and development of scalable and efficient data driven solutions.
  • Input into the design decisions determining optimal data science methodologies and technologies to use to solve the problem at hand.
  • Ensuring integrity of the data science solutions in terms of the underlying statistical and economic models and assumptions.
  • Collaborating with the MLOps team in the development and deployment of proposed solutions to a live environment and tracking the effects in real time.
  • Devising statistically robust testing plans to validate effectiveness of solutions.
  • Collating results from in-market tests and validating them.
  • Effectively communicating outputs of work to other team members and business stakeholders in a manner that can be understood by both technical and non-technical audiences.
  • Work with colleagues in Revenue function to ensure they are equipped with required tools, models and resources for optimising trading performance.
  • Support the wider business with BAU tasks related to the services Data Science provide or with designing new data-driven solutions to solve their complex business problems.
  • Proactively work with wider data & technology teams to support the collection of new data and refinement of existing data sources.

Knowledge and Skills:

  • Undergraduate, M.S. or Ph.D. in a relevant quantitative field, and 3+ years’ experience in a relevant role.
  • Solid understanding of statistical modelling, algorithms, data mining and machine learning workflows.
  • Some experience or knowledge of using more advanced ML libraries (TensorFlow, PyTorch, MXnet, etc.).
  • Experience in the development or application of GenAI algorithms seen as a plus.
  • Proficient in writing well structured, robust and readable code in Python.
  • Proficient in SQL and relevant experience using relational databases.
  • Ability to communicate complex quantitative analysis in a clear, precise, and actionable manner.
  • Proven experience manipulating and analysing complex, high-volume, high-dimensional data from varying sources.
  • Ability to create compelling visualisations and dashboards (e.g. Tableau, Thoughtspot).
  • Knowledge of Git and modern development workflows.
  • Proven ability to work creatively and analytically in a fast-paced, problem-solving environment.
  • Ability to partner with Software Engineering teams to co-develop functionality for the business.
